Output 9809167b3f7bcdf875e39e1165f6a33e4375f55d16c42ea14d76019b44a26864:0

value
1338000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ac1e23345566c956880e782f17eeb25100b6cd OP_EQUAL
address
3MMPPjfhexPmFyMzda2wvXaAr2fhdhyiru
transaction
9809167b3f7bcdf875e39e1165f6a33e4375f55d16c42ea14d76019b44a26864
confirmations
423817
spent
true